As a Senior Design Engineer for the Small Track-Type Tractors (STTT) product team you will have the opportunity to contribute to the detailed design, development, and validation of the STTT’s designed in Clayton, NC and built in Athens, GA. This position will work New Product Introduction (NPI) and Continuous Product Improvement (CPI) projects and play a key role in concept, design, development, and validation of the STTT.

Since 1925, Caterpillar Inc. has been helping our customers build a better world – making sustainable progress possible and driving positive change on every continent. With 2020 sales and revenues of $41.7 billion, Caterpillar Inc. is the world’s leading manufacturer of construction and mining equipment, diesel and natural gas engines, industrial gas turbines, and diesel-electric locomotives. We do business on every continent, principally operating through three primary segments – Construction Industries, Resource Industries, and Energy & Transportation – and providing financing and related services through our Financial Products segment.
